How does the ToeCoach address both bunions and hammer toes simultaneously?
The patented design positions a spacer element between the 1st and 2nd toes to push the big toe back toward neutral alignment, relieving bunion pressure. At the same time, a cushioning element wraps under and over the 2nd toe to support a hammer toe or contracted toe and protect the toe tip from shoe contact. This dual function is built into the single device geometry, so both conditions are addressed with one product worn in the same position.
Can this be worn inside shoes during daily activity?
Yes. The soft Visco-GEL material is flexible and low-profile enough to fit inside most standard footwear during daily activity. Shoes with a wider toe box will be more comfortable with the device in place. Very narrow or pointed-toe shoes may not accommodate the device comfortably. Try the device with your shoes before committing to extended wear to confirm fit and comfort.
Is this a corrective device or a comfort device?
The ToeCoach provides passive alignment and cushioning during wear — it repositions the toe while the device is on and relieves pressure and friction during that time. It is not a rigid orthotic that permanently corrects toe deformity. For individuals with mild to moderate bunions or hammer toes, consistent daily wear can help manage symptoms and slow progression. For severe deformity or significant pain, consult a podiatrist for a comprehensive treatment plan.
